http://www.clintoncity.com/ WebIn 2024, Clinton, UT had a population of 22.2k people with a median age of 30 and a median household income of $88,023. Between 2024 and 2024 the population of Clinton, UT grew from 21,890 to 22,191, a 1.38% increase and its median household income grew from $82,161 to $88,023, a 7.13% increase.

WebA History of Clinton, Utah County, Utah, from the Utah Place Names. Written by John W. Van Cott. ... History of Clinton (Davis County), Utah. Taken from the Utah Place Names (Links Added) CLINTON. Clinton is one mile west of Sunset and two miles southwest of Roy on U-37. During the 1870s, James Hill and his family settled this small village ...
